Describing Archives: A Content Standard

Describing Archives: A Content Standard (DACS) is a set of rules for describing archives, personal papers, and manuscript collections. The descriptive standard can be utilized for all types of archival material. In 2004, DACS was adopted by the Society of American Archivists as an official SAA standard.[1]

Relation to other standards

Upon adoption by SAA, DACS superseded the former standard for archival material, Archives, Personal Papers, and Manuscripts (APPM). It has now been widely adopted by the archival community throughout the United States. Also, DACS expands on the basic rules for describing archival material that are found in chapter 4 of the cataloging standard, AACR2. DACS also provides crosswalks from DACS to MARC and Encoded Archival Description (EAD). DACS specifies only the type of content, not the structural or encoding requirements or the actual verbiage to be used; it is therefore suitable for use in conjunction with structural and encoding standards such as MARC and EAD and with controlled vocabularies such as MeSH, LCSH, AAT, and so on.

It should also be noted that DACS is the US implementation of international archival descriptive standards such as ISAD(G) and ISAAR(CPF).
